Decoding Your Genetic Hand: How to Identify Your Inherited Risk Factors
Understanding your genetic risk isn’t about blaming your parents; it’s about empowering yourself with knowledge. Your genes don’t guarantee blackheads, but they can create a perfect storm of conditions that make them more likely. The key is to look for specific traits and patterns that are known to be genetically linked to this common skin concern.
- Pore Size and Density: This is often the most obvious genetic indicator. Do you have visibly large pores, especially on your nose and T-zone? Pore size is largely hereditary. Larger pores mean more space for sebum, dead skin cells, and debris to accumulate, forming the basis of a blackhead. Take a close look in a magnifying mirror. If your pores are prominent, you have a higher baseline risk.
- Actionable Example: If you’ve inherited large pores, your primary focus should be on keeping them consistently clean and “tight.” Use a clay mask (like bentonite or kaolin) two to three times a week to draw out impurities. Incorporate a BHA (beta hydroxy acid) like salicylic acid into your daily routine. Salicylic acid is oil-soluble, allowing it to penetrate deep into pores to dissolve the gunk that leads to blackheads.
- Sebum Production Rate: Are you naturally on the oilier side? Do you find yourself blotting your T-zone by midday? Your skin’s oil production rate is a heavily genetic trait. Overactive sebaceous glands mean a constant supply of sebum, which, when oxidized by air, is the defining component of a blackhead.
- Actionable Example: For those with genetically oily skin, a multi-pronged approach is necessary. Start your day with a gentle foaming cleanser to remove excess oil without stripping your skin. Follow up with a niacinamide serum. Niacinamide is known to help regulate sebum production over time. In the evening, use a retinol or retinoid. Retinoids not only speed up cell turnover but also help normalize oil production, making them a powerful tool against blackheads.
- Cell Turnover Rate: Blackheads are essentially a clog of dead skin cells and oil. Your skin’s natural exfoliation process, or cell turnover, is genetically predetermined. If your skin sheds cells slowly, those dead cells can linger and mix with sebum, creating a perfect plug.
- Actionable Example: If you suspect slow cell turnover (your skin often looks dull or you get blackheads even when your skin isn’t particularly oily), chemical exfoliation is your best friend. Introduce an AHA (alpha hydroxy acid) like glycolic acid or lactic acid. Use an AHA toner or serum a few nights a week to gently dissolve the bonds holding dead skin cells together, preventing them from clogging your pores.

Building Your Genetic-Smart Skincare Routine: A Practical Framework
Once you’ve decoded your genetic predispositions, you can stop guessing and start building a routine that addresses your specific needs. This isn’t a one-size-fits-all approach; it’s a targeted strategy.
- Start with a Pore-Targeting Cleanser: The foundation of any blackhead-fighting routine is a good cleanser. For those with a genetic predisposition, a simple, gentle cleanser isn’t enough. You need one that works harder. Look for cleansers containing salicylic acid (BHA) or charcoal.
- Actionable Example: In the morning, use a gentle, hydrating cleanser. In the evening, when you’re removing a day’s worth of oil, makeup, and pollution, switch to a cleanser with a 1-2% concentration of salicylic acid. This provides a deep clean without over-drying, which can trigger your skin to produce even more oil.
- Integrate Targeted Actives: This is where you get to the root of the problem. Your genes might dictate your skin’s behavior, but these ingredients can modify it. The trio of BHA, retinol, and niacinamide are your most powerful allies.
- Actionable Example:
- BHA (Salicylic Acid): Use a BHA toner or serum daily or every other day, after cleansing. It works inside the pore to dissolve the gunk.

Retinoids (Retinol, Retinaldehyde): Use a retinoid serum or cream 2-3 times a week at night. Start with a lower concentration and build up slowly. Retinoids normalize skin cell turnover and oil production, two key genetic factors in blackhead formation.

Niacinamide: Use a niacinamide serum daily, both morning and night. It’s a great all-rounder that helps regulate oil, minimize the appearance of pores, and strengthen the skin barrier.

Masking with a Purpose: Not all masks are created equal. For a genetically predisposed skin type, your mask should be a deep-cleaning tool, not just a pampering session.
- Actionable Example: Incorporate a clay or charcoal mask into your routine once or twice a week. Apply it only to your T-zone or other areas where blackheads are a problem. This targeted application ensures you’re not over-drying the rest of your face. Look for masks with added ingredients like sulfur or bentonite clay, known for their ability to draw out impurities.
The Lifestyle Connection: Modifying Your Environment to Support Your Genes
Your genes may set the stage, but your lifestyle determines the outcome. By making smart, targeted lifestyle choices, you can create an environment that minimizes your genetic risk.
- Sun Protection is Non-Negotiable: Sun exposure can exacerbate blackheads. UV rays can thicken the skin’s outer layer, making it harder for sebum to flow freely out of the pores. This creates a perfect condition for clogs.
- Actionable Example: Make a non-comedogenic, broad-spectrum sunscreen a daily habit, regardless of the weather. Look for formulas with “mineral” or “physical” filters like zinc oxide or titanium dioxide, which are generally less irritating and less likely to clog pores.
- Hydration from the Inside Out: Many people with oily, blackhead-prone skin avoid moisturizers, fearing they’ll make the problem worse. This is a mistake. Dehydrated skin can overcompensate by producing even more oil.
- Actionable Example: Choose a lightweight, oil-free moisturizer with ingredients like hyaluronic acid or glycerin. These ingredients attract water to the skin without adding oil. You’re giving your skin the hydration it needs, which can help it regulate its own oil production more effectively.
- Manage Your Stress Levels: Cortisol, the stress hormone, can trigger your sebaceous glands to produce more oil. If you have a genetic predisposition for oily skin, stress can push it into overdrive.
- Actionable Example: Integrate stress-reducing activities into your daily life. This could be as simple as a 10-minute meditation, a short walk, or listening to music. Managing your stress isn’t just good for your mental health; it’s a direct intervention in your skin’s oil production.
